Output 20d5432256c99f806f2abb4091e5b450c2ed387d6424eee86c192e85e5e42548:33

value
6276636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52aabef764403393b3aad3691cf6b712e36a4540 OP_EQUAL
address
MFSGBoDpzGu3H88ZkuyX465NqVbwb8uM2D
transaction
20d5432256c99f806f2abb4091e5b450c2ed387d6424eee86c192e85e5e42548
spent
true